Project portfolio management (PPM) is the centralized management of all projects within an organization to ensure that they align with the overall strategic goals, deliver value, and are executed efficiently. A PMO, or project management office, can be an internal department or an external group or agency that defines and maintains the standards for a company’s project management. PMBOK 7 is the short name given to The Standard for Project Management and A Guide to the Project Management Body of Knowledge – ( PMBOK® Guide ) 7 th Edition , which are bundled together. They form the basics of what you need to know about managing projects, for organizations that follow the PMI approach to getting work done.

An effective Project Management Office (PMO) in an organization is a must nowadays. It helps standardize project management practices, ensure alignment with organizational strategy, and provide oversight to deliver projects successfully. In your project management career, you’ll have multiple opportunities to perform different project management roles ranging from a project analyst to a program manager. A typical project manager career path takes this progression: Project Coordinator. Project Manager. Senior Project Manager. Program Manager.
